Roger became our new Lead Pastor in August 2007. He came from the Aldersgate United Methodist Church of Marion, Illinois - the largest United Methodist Church in Southern Illinois. Roger and his wife Joye have been married since 1985. They have two boys, Samuel and Levi, as well as a dog named Skippy Duke. Even though Roger is a Duke graduate, he and the family are excited about being avid University of Illinois fans - just as long as they are not playing Duke. Roger's call to ministry is to lead others to Jesus Christ and to help disciples grow and develop in their faith. Roger enjoys the time he can spend with Joye, Samuel and Levi. Roger collects and plays old stringed instruments. He enjoys woodcarving, painting, photography, antiques, hiking, fishing, biking, basketball, and chess. Roger loves the wilderness and wildlife. An interesting fact about Roger is that he hiked over 150 miles across the state of Illinois through the Shawnee National Forest two years ago. There is one word that keeps Roger from getting a Harley Davidson motorcycle - Joye.
